I do strongman training and I am looking for some good knee sleeves and elbow sleeves. Sleeves that I can wear when deadlifting, ohp etc. but also can wear on my events day. I need to be comfortable and be able to do moving events in them. What would you guys suggest. I've looked into elitefts sleeves but don't want to pull the trigger and buy them without researching first.

I would not recommend the EliteFTS sleeves.
The best knee sleeves that you can get are the old style blue rehband sleeves, they are a bit expensive but are worth the price. You can purchase them from Jackal's Gym. If you are looking for something more economical then I would recommend Tommy Kono sleeves - they are about half the price and are made from 5mm neoprene so they still provide some good heat/compression. Just stay away from the grey/black rehbands.
For elbow sleeves I would go with cloth sleeves from APT, the NanoFlex from Dino's Gym (heard good things but have not tried them), or neoprene sleeves like the ones above. A lot of it comes down to personal preference.

I have APT knee and elbow sleeves and like them a lot, although I have some cheapo neoprene knee sleeves that I use for strongman days. The cloth APT sleeves on my knees are a bit restrictive for moving events.
I second not getting EliteFTS sleeves. I've heard bad things about them including funky sizing issues.

I have Elite's Knee sleeves and I like them but the sizing is very subjective. If you're willing to ship them back if they don't fit right you might consider them. They are also pretty tight and somewhat restrictive.
I also have APT sleeves and Inzer XT's and I much prefer them to the Elite's.

Depending on why you want sleeves I would recommend either the Blue Rehband or APT sleeves(red and black stripe ones). I use the APT sleeves on almost everything, but only use the rehband when I'm training in the cold or where then inside out on my shins when I do deadlift.
Just to elaborate on my previous post I have used APT sleeves for years and definitely recommend them.
I use APT double ply 'Convict' knee sleeves for heavy squatting or static events, and blue rehband or TK sleeves for general warmth. For elbow sleeves I usually use the APT 'Heavy Duty' (black/red) sleeves.
